#73a9ee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#73a9ee is composed of 45.1% red, 66.3% green and 93.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 51.7% cyan, 29% magenta, 0% yellow and 6.7% black. It has a hue angle of 213.7 degrees, a saturation of 78.3% and a lightness of 69.2%. #73a9ee color hex could be obtained by blending #e6ffff with #0053dd. Closest websafe color is: #6699ff.

Shades and Tints of #73a9ee

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020911 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.
